What am I required to do in this assignment?

You must write a 10000 word (+/-10%) research dissertation. It is important to remember that your dissertation is where you set out the research project you have undertaken (the project you proposed in assignment one). As such, your methods section (where you clearly explain your research design, data collection methods, and analysis) and your findings are the core of your dissertation. You will provide background context before your methods and findings sections and will follow these with a discussion where you explore the implications of your findings and make connections to the relevant background context. You will conclude by revisiting your research question and
considering what your research has allowed you to say in answer to this question. You may also make recommendations for research, policy and practice as and where this is relevant.

What do I need to do to pass? (Threshold Expectations from UIF)

Produce a 10,000 word Research Study, logically structured, articulate, convincingly conclusive, and referenced according to the format and standard of the Harvard system.

Include a comprehensive literature review of the chosen area, which displays a critical grasp of the findings.

Select appropriate methods, providing a rationale for their selection, applying these methods, presenting the data obtained in an appropriate format, evaluating the limitations of the chosen methods, addressing and resolving ethical issues and drawing conclusions from the data.

Evidence the application of critical knowledge of relevant theoretical frameworks with evidence of critical appraisal and synthesis including how your work can make a difference or create change.
